dc.description.abstractSome new higher order iterative methods are obtained to approximate the positive square root of a positive real number. Moreover some numerical tests are performed to demonstrate the performances and accuracies of the new methods. The numerical results show that the methods we obtain are competitive with the existing ones. (c) 2005 Published by Elsevier Inc.en_US
